The Benefits of Real-Time ddos Attack Analysis

During a DDoS attack it’s extremely useful to have granular security event data so that in the event of an anomalous attack, network security managers can quickly adapt their DDoS mitigation efforts. DDoS hackers have become sophisticated in their attack strategies; i.e., they now typically use multi-vector attacks, and they automate their attacks, changing vectors on the fly. Often, volumetric attacks are used as a smoke screen to hide low and slow application layer attacks. Furthermore, cybercriminals sometimes leverage the power of one botnet to launch pulse-wave, also known as burst, attacks that alternate between two or more targets. In these situations, visibility into the real-time attack definitely helps a Security Operations Center (SOC) effectively counter an attack appropriately with custom mitigations. Granular detection into traffic anomalies can provide guidance into possible configuration changes.

How can you earn this certification?

There is the only one way to earn this CompTIA certification – you should pass the certification exam.

The CompTIA Mobility+ (MB0-001) exam covers mobile device management, troubleshooting, security such as remote access concerns and threat mitigation, and network infrastructure.

The MB0-001 exam consists of 100 multiple choice questions and drag and drops, and lasts 90 minutes.

The recommended experience includes at least 18 months of work experience in administration of mobile devices in the enterprise and the availability of the Network+ certification or equivalent working knowledge.

CompTIA reserves the right to insert ungraded beta questions. As the name implies, CompTIA is “trying them out” to see how folks react. Most testers aren’t aware of these beta questions and it seems CompTIA puts them right at the beginning of the exam – which is a guaranteed panic-inducer.
If you see questions on the exam that cover topics that you’ve never seen, there’s a great chance they’re beta questions. Go ahead and try your best to guess an answer, but don’t let them upset you – they’re not graded.
